Vegetables Mixed Nutrients FAQs
Nutrients
- Vitamin A:Vegetables Mixed has 4000 IU of Vitamin A.
- Vitamin C:Vegetables Mixed has 3.6 mg of Vitamin C.
- Vegetables Mixed has 26mg of Calcium.
- Vegetables Mixed has 400mg of Sodium, Na.
- Vegetables Mixed has 1.08mg of Iron.
What is the calorie content of Vegetables Mixed?
A typical serving 0.5 cup (125 grams) of Vegetables Mixed contains approximately 40 calories.

Health Benefits of Vegetables Mixed
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ed supports eye health.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ed is essential for maintaining good vision and preventing night blindness by supporting the function of the retina.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ed boosts immune function.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ed helps strengthen the immune system by promoting the production of white blood cells, which fight infections.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ed promotes healthy skin.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ed supports skin health by enhancing cell production and repair, preventing dryness, and reducing the risk of acne.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ed enhances reproductive health.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ed plays a role in maintaining healthy reproduction systems in both men and women.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ed supports bone health.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ed contributes to proper bone growth and development, working alongside other nutrients like calcium and vitamin D.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ed reduces the risk of certain cancers.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ed helps protect cells from damage caused by free radicals, potentially lowering the risk of certain cancers.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ed promotes healthy development during pregnancy.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ed is crucial for the healthy growth and development of the fetus, particularly for organ formation and the immune system.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ed maintains healthy mucous membranes.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ed helps keep mucous membranes in the respiratory, digestive, and urinary tracts healthy, reducing infection risks.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ed improves wound healing.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ed promotes faster recovery by supporting the repair and regeneration of skin tissue.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ed may reduce the risk of macular degeneration.
Vitamin A in Vegetables Mixed, especially in its beta-carotene form, is linked to a lower risk of age-related macular degeneration, a leading cause of vision loss.
